New Hope International Ministries
New Hope International Ministries is committed to lifting up the name of the Lord and preaching the gospel to lead lost souls to our great Savior Jesus Christ.
We are a non-denominational church that believes in Christ crucified on the cross for our sins. If you confess with your mouth and believe in your heart that God raised Jesus from the dead, then thou art saved.

We invite you to join us in honoring the life and legacy of our beloved Senior Pastor, Lamarr P. Jamerson, Sr.
Along with his loving wife, Deborah Jamerson, he founded New Hope International Ministries in 2004, touching countless lives with his unwavering faith and dedication to God's Word.
Let us come together to celebrate a life well-lived and a legacy that will continue to inspire generations to come.
